What amount of money must you invest at 6.8% compounded monthly, in order to have $10,000 after 10 years? Round your answer to the nearest dollar.

The amount of money which is invested at 6.8% compounded monthly, in order to have $10,000 after 10 year is $5076.

What is compound interest?

Compound interest is the amount charged on the principal amount and the accumulated interest with a fixed rate of interest for a time period.

The formula for the final amount with the compound interest formula can be given as,

[tex]A=P\times\left(1+\dfrac{r}{n\times100}\right)^{nt}\\[/tex]

Here, A is the final amount (principal plus interest amount) on the principal amount P of with the rate r of in the time period of t.

The rate of interest is 6.8% on the amount which is compounded monthly

The value of final amount is $10,000 after the time period of 10 years. There are total 12 months a year. Thus, the value of principal amount using the above formula is,

[tex]10000=P\times\left(1+\dfrac{6.8}{12\times100}\right)^{12\times10}\\10000=P\times1.97\\P=\dfrac{10000}{1.97}\\P=5076.14\\P\approx5076[/tex]

Thus, the amount of money which is invested at 6.8% compounded monthly, in order to have $10,000 after 10 year is $5076.
